* WritingAroundTrademarks: The reason for Tusky's name change in ''Wee Singdom''. According to Beall and Nipp, a "Tusky the Elephant" was already trademarked prior to ''Wee Sing Train''. The holders of the original copyright agreed to not press charges as long as the name was changed should he make any reappearances, hence why he's called Trunky in ''Wee Singdom''.

* MeaningfulName: Some of the characters in Marvelous Musical Mansion are named after musical terminology that's appropriate to their characters:
** Rubato means "played freely and loosely," and Uncle Rubato has the power to levitate, ''freeing'' himself from gravity's pull.
** The Tap-A-Capella Singers are all named different indicators for tempo and volume: Ally Allegro (quickly), Lawrence Largo (slowly), Flo Fortissimo (loudly), Peter Pianissimo (softly).

It all started with two elementary music teachers, Pam Beall and Susan Nipp, who bonded over favorite childhood songs they wanted to share with their children and students. Realizing that they couldn’t remember all the words or even some of the melodies, they began a long and difficult search through collections of children’s songs. Slowly they discovered that the music from their childhood and that of their parents was being forgotten. In an effort to preserve it, they decided to create a book filled with favorite children’s songs to help not only themselves but all interested families share the joy of music together, titled "Wee Sing Children’s Songs and Fingerplays".
Pam and Susan continued to develop new titles for the Wee Sing series after their first book became an enormous success. In 1981, they broke new ground in children’s publishing with the addition of audiocassettes to their established songbook collection. This was taken one step further in 1985, when the first Wee Sing video, "Wee Sing Together", was produced, beginning a series of direct-to-video musical films that continued until 1996. They were then followed by two less successful sing-along videos made up of recycled songs from the previous videos.
These videos include:
* "Wee Sing Together" (1985)
* "King Cole's Party" (1987)
* "Grandpa's Magical Toys" (1988)
* "Wee Sing in Sillyville" (1989)
* "The Best Christmas Ever" (1990)
* "Wee Sing in the Big Rock Candy Mountains" (1991)
* "Wee Sing in the Marvelous Musical Mansion" (1992)
* "The Wee Sing Train" (1993)
* "Wee Sing Under the Sea" (1994)
